/foundation/multimedia/media_foundation/engine/plugin/core/ |
H A D | plugin_register.cpp | 202 info->inCaps = base.inCaps; in InitMuxerInfo() 247 info->inCaps = base.inCaps; in InitOutputSinkInfo() 258 info->inCaps = base.inCaps; in InitGenericPlugin() 276 info->inCaps = base.inCaps; in DemuxerCapabilityConvert() 284 info->inCaps = base.inCaps; in CodecCapabilityConvert() [all...] |
H A D | plugin_info.h | 35 * Typically, plugin have inputs and outputs, those capabilities are described by inCaps and outCaps. 47 CapabilitySet inCaps; member
|
/foundation/multimedia/media_foundation/engine/include/plugin/interface/ |
H A D | output_sink_plugin.h | 58 CapabilitySet inCaps; member 64 inCaps.emplace_back(Capability("*")); ///< Output sink sink can accept any data in OutputSinkPluginDef()
|
H A D | generic_plugin.h | 34 CapabilitySet inCaps {}; ///< Plug-in input capability, For details, @see Capability.
|
H A D | video_sink_plugin.h | 109 CapabilitySet inCaps; ///< Plug-in input capability, For details, @see Capability. member
|
H A D | audio_sink_plugin.h | 211 CapabilitySet inCaps {}; ///< Plug-in input capability, For details, @see Capability.
|
H A D | codec_plugin.h | 138 CapabilitySet inCaps {}; ///< Plug-in input capability, For details, @see Capability.
|
H A D | muxer_plugin.h | 53 CapabilitySet inCaps; ///< Plug-in input capability, For details, @see Capability. member
|
H A D | demuxer_plugin.h | 214 CapabilitySet inCaps; ///< Plug-in input capability, For details, @see Capability. member
|
/foundation/multimedia/media_foundation/interface/inner_api/plugin/ |
H A D | plugin_definition.h | 168 inCaps.emplace_back(capability); in AddInCaps() 192 return inCaps; in GetInCaps() 222 CapabilitySet inCaps; ///< Plug-in input capability, For details, @see Capability. member
|
H A D | generic_plugin.h | 34 CapabilitySet inCaps {}; ///< Plug-in input capability, For details, @see Capability.
|
H A D | plugin_info.h | 35 * Typically, plugin have inputs and outputs, those capabilities are described by inCaps and outCaps. 47 CapabilitySet inCaps; member
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/codec_adapter/ |
H A D | hdi_codec_manager.cpp | 89 def.inCaps = codecCapability.inCaps; in RegisterCodecPlugins() 146 codecCapability.inCaps.push_back(incapBuilder.Build()); in AddHdiCap()
|
H A D | codec_manager.h | 30 CapabilitySet inCaps{}; ///< Plug-in input capability, For details, @see Capability.
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/sink/audio_server_sink/ |
H A D | audio_server_sink_plugin.cpp | 133 void UpdateSupportedSampleRate(Capability& inCaps) in UpdateSupportedSampleRate() argument 145 inCaps.AppendDiscreteKeys<uint32_t>(Capability::Key::AUDIO_SAMPLE_RATE, values); in UpdateSupportedSampleRate() 150 void UpdateSupportedSampleFormat(Capability& inCaps) in UpdateSupportedSampleFormat() argument 159 inCaps.AppendDiscreteKeys(Capability::Key::AUDIO_SAMPLE_FORMAT, values); in UpdateSupportedSampleFormat() 169 Capability inCaps(OHOS::Media::MEDIA_MIME_AUDIO_RAW); in AudioServerSinkRegister() 170 UpdateSupportedSampleRate(inCaps); in AudioServerSinkRegister() 171 UpdateSupportedSampleFormat(inCaps); in AudioServerSinkRegister() 172 definition.inCaps.push_back(inCaps); in AudioServerSinkRegister()
|
/foundation/distributedhardware/distributed_hardware_fwk/av_transport/av_trans_handler/histreamer_ability_querier/src/ |
H A D | histreamer_ability_querier.cpp | 104 std::vector<AudioEncoderIn> ParseAudioEncoderIn(CapabilitySet &inCaps) in ParseAudioEncoderIn() argument 107 for (auto &cap : inCaps) { in ParseAudioEncoderIn() 148 audioEncoder.ins = ParseAudioEncoderIn(pluginInfo->inCaps); in QueryAudioEncoderAbility() 326 std::vector<AudioDecoderIn> ParseAudioDecoderIn(CapabilitySet &inCaps) in ParseAudioDecoderIn() argument 329 for (auto &cap : inCaps) { in ParseAudioDecoderIn() 370 audioDecoder.ins = ParseAudioDecoderIn(pluginInfo->inCaps); in QueryAudioDecoderAbility() 535 std::vector<VideoEncoderIn> ParseVideoEncoderIn(CapabilitySet &inCaps) in ParseVideoEncoderIn() argument 538 for (auto &cap : inCaps) { in ParseVideoEncoderIn() 578 videoEncoder.ins = ParseVideoEncoderIn(pluginInfo->inCaps); in QueryVideoEncoderAbility() 731 std::vector<VideoDecoderIn> ParseVideoDecoderIn(CapabilitySet &inCaps) in ParseVideoDecoderIn() argument [all...] |
/foundation/multimedia/av_codec/services/media_engine/plugins/sink/ |
H A D | audio_server_sink_plugin.cpp | 84 void UpdateSupportedSampleRate(Capability &inCaps) in UpdateSupportedSampleRate() argument 93 inCaps.AppendDiscreteKeys<uint32_t>(OHOS::Media::Tag::AUDIO_SAMPLE_RATE, values); in UpdateSupportedSampleRate() 98 void UpdateSupportedSampleFormat(Capability &inCaps) in UpdateSupportedSampleFormat() argument 107 inCaps.AppendDiscreteKeys(OHOS::Media::Tag::AUDIO_SAMPLE_FORMAT, values); in UpdateSupportedSampleFormat() 120 Capability inCaps(MimeType::AUDIO_RAW); in AudioServerSinkRegister() 121 UpdateSupportedSampleRate(inCaps); in AudioServerSinkRegister() 122 UpdateSupportedSampleFormat(inCaps); in AudioServerSinkRegister() 123 definition.AddInCaps(inCaps); in AudioServerSinkRegister()
|
/foundation/distributedhardware/distributed_hardware_fwk/av_transport/av_trans_engine/filters/av_transport_output/ |
H A D | av_transport_output_filter.cpp | 191 if (info == nullptr || info->inCaps.empty() || mime != info->inCaps[0].mime) { in FindPlugin() 211 negotiatedCap = pluginInfo_->inCaps[0]; in Negotiate()
|
/foundation/distributedhardware/distributed_hardware_fwk/av_transport/av_trans_engine/plugin/plugins/av_trans_output/dscreen_output/ |
H A D | dscreen_output_plugin.cpp | 42 definition.inCaps.push_back(inCap); in CreateDscreenOutputPluginDef()
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/ffmpeg_adapter/muxer/ |
H A D | ffmpeg_muxer_plugin.cpp | 62 UpdatePluginInCapability(oFmt->audio_codec, pluginDef.inCaps); in UpdatePluginCapability() 63 UpdatePluginInCapability(oFmt->video_codec, pluginDef.inCaps); in UpdatePluginCapability() 64 UpdatePluginInCapability(oFmt->subtitle_codec, pluginDef.inCaps); in UpdatePluginCapability()
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/sink/video_surface_sink/ |
H A D | surface_sink_plugin.cpp | 48 definition.inCaps.emplace_back(cap); in SurfaceSinkRegister()
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/lite_aac_decoder/ |
H A D | lite_aac_decoder_plugin.cpp | 72 definition.inCaps.push_back(capBuilder.Build());
in UpdateInCaps()
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/minimp3_adapter/ |
H A D | minimp3_decoder_plugin.cpp | 269 definition.inCaps.push_back(capBuilder.Build());
in UpdateInCaps()
|
/foundation/distributedhardware/distributed_hardware_fwk/av_transport/av_trans_engine/plugin/plugins/av_trans_output/daudio_output/ |
H A D | daudio_output_plugin.cpp | 47 definition.inCaps.push_back(capBuilder.Build()); in CreateDaudioOutputPluginDef()
|
/foundation/multimedia/media_foundation/engine/plugin/plugins/sink/sdl/video_sink/ |
H A D | sdl_video_sink_plugin.cpp | 48 definition.inCaps.emplace_back(cap); in SdlVideoRegister()
|